Blake Wagenseller Enters 2017 Top Five With 6.45
After a 6.45 from Stanford commit 2017 OF Blake Wagenseller (Poway, CA) at the February 7 Under Armour Baseball Factory National Tryout in San Diego, only five hundredths of a second separate the top five runners in the class of 2017.
Wagenseller’s 6.45 earned him solo fifth-place in the 2017 class, with the times of 6.40, 6.41, 6.42 and 6.44 just ahead of him seemingly within reach. We’ve seen some recent movement at the very top, with OF Cole Brannen (Elko, GA) gaining on current leader OF Garrett Mitchell (Anaheim, CA) in a move from 6.43 to 6.41 at the 2016 Under Armour All-America Pre-Season Tournament. Both Brannen and Mitchell are selections for the 2016 Under Armour All-America Game, scheduled for July 23 at Wrigley Field in Chicago.
Also in San Diego, SS Nate Smolinski (La Jolla, CA) ran 6.90 to tie for the seventh-fastest time so far among 2019 graduates, and 2017 OF/RHP Sean Ross (El Cajon, CA) posted 6.75 to mark an improvement of nearly two tenths of a second since the 2015 Under Armour Futures West Showcase.
At the Mobile, AL tryout, 2B Landon Jordan (Poplarville, MS) ran 6.63 to enter fifth-place on his own in the class of 2018, and 2B Will Baker (Dothan, AL) posted 6.75 to join the class of 2017 leaderboard.
Hometown boy 2017 2B Ryan Kasper ran 6.73 at the Tomball, TX tryout, while OF John Tyler Mounce (Cypress, TX) ran 6.84 to take over third-place among 2019 graduates.
